The Buckner Company is Hiring a Corporate Wellness Specialist Near Salt Lake, UT

Position Title: Wellness Specialist
Classification: Non-exempt
Reports To: Chief Growth Office
Hours: Part-Time (20-25 hours a week) or Contract
Location: Salt Lake Office
Compensation: $23 to $26/hr.

Position Summary:The Wellness Program Liaison serves as the primary point of contact between the organization and insurance carriers, ensuring effective communication and collaboration on wellness programs. This role involves program promotion, partnership development, program management, and collaboration with client advisors to maximize client participation and satisfaction in wellness initiatives. This role requires a proactive and detail-oriented professional with strong communication and organizational skills, capable of fostering productive relationships with insurance carriers, vendors, and clients to promote and manage wellness programs effectively.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ities:Liaison Duties:
  • Serve as the primary point of contact between the organization and insurance carriers for wellness programs
  • Collaborate with insurance carriers to resolve client issues and questions about wellness programs
  • Ensure that clients receive accurate and timely information about wellness benefits
  • Maintain a comprehensive understanding of wellness programs offered by various insurance carriers
  • Stay updated on changes and new offerings in wellness programs from insurance partners
Program Promotion:
  • Design and implement strategies to increase client participation in wellness programs
  • Use data and feedback to continuously improve program engagement and client satisfaction
Partnership Development:
  • Identify and establish partnerships with vendors to enhance wellness program offerings
  • Negotiate and manage vendor contracts and agreements
  • Collaborate with vendors to develop and implement new wellness initiatives and resources
Program Management:
  • Organize and lead wellness program kickoff meetings to introduce and explain program benefits to clients
  • Conduct quarterly meetings to review program utilization, assess effectiveness, and identify areas for improvement
  • Prepare and present utilization reports and feedback summaries to stakeholders and management
Client Advisor Collaboration:
  • Present wellness programs and benefits in collaboration with client advisors at pitch meetings
  • Develop customized presentations and materials to highlight program advantages to prospective clients
  • Engage with potential clients to address their specific needs and demonstrate how wellness programs can meet those needs
  • Study insurance claims data to identify trends and areas of need
  • Develop and implement solutions based on claims data analysis to improve wellness outcomes and reduce costs
